Equal Employment Opportunity Commission v. Brookdale Senior Living Communities, Inc
Equal Employment Opportunity Commission v. Brookdale Senior Living Communities, Inc is a federal civil rights lawsuit filed on 08/07/2019 in the District Court, S.D. Indiana. The case was terminated on 12/17/2019.

About Civil Rights Lawsuits
Civil rights lawsuits allege violations of constitutional or statutory rights, including employment discrimination, voting rights, disability access, and claims against government actors. Employment-discrimination claims are among the most common in federal court.
